Private Advisor Group LLC Acquires 10,295 Shares of Thermo Fisher Scientific Inc. (NYSE:TMO)

Private Advisor Group LLC boosted its holdings in Thermo Fisher Scientific Inc. (NYSE:TMOFree Report) by 88.0% during the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 21,996 shares of the medical research company’s stock after buying an additional 10,295 shares during the period. Private Advisor Group LLC’s holdings in Thermo Fisher Scientific were worth $11,676,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Thermo Fisher Scientific Stock Performance

NYSE TMO traded up $0.09 during trading on Tuesday, reaching $573.64. 684,875 shares of the company’s stock were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 1,534,744. Thermo Fisher Scientific Inc. has a fifty-two week low of $415.60 and a fifty-two week high of $603.82. The stock has a market capitalization of $218.96 billion, a P/E ratio of 36.79, a PEG ratio of 2.37 and a beta of 0.80. The business has a 50 day moving average price of $575.59 and a 200-day moving average price of $534.36.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.68, a current ratio of 1.70 and a quick ratio of 1.33.

Thermo Fisher Scientific (NYSE:TMOG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, April 24th. The medical research company reported $5.11 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$4.70 by $0.41. The company had revenue of $10.35 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$10.14 billion. Thermo Fisher Scientific had a net margin of 14.20% and a return on equity of 18.45%. Sell-side analysts forecast that Thermo Fisher Scientific Inc. will post 21.64 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Thermo Fisher Scientific Profile

(Free Report)

Thermo Fisher Scientific Inc provides life sciences solutions, analytical instruments, specialty diagnostics, and laboratory products and biopharma services in the North America, Europe, Asia-Pacific, and internationally. The company's Life Sciences Solutions segment offers reagents, instruments, and consumables for biological and medical research, discovery, and production of drugs and vaccines, as well as diagnosis of infections and diseases; and solutions include biosciences, genetic sciences, and bio production to pharmaceutical, biotechnology, agricultural, clinical, healthcare, academic, and government markets.
